Wait, withdrawal effects!?

What are the withdrawal effects from THC use?

  • Irritability, anger, and aggression

  • Anxiety and nervousness

  • Restlessness and difficulty concentrating

  • Depressed mood or low motivation

  • Sleep disturbances, including insomnia, vivid or disturbing dreams, and nightmares

  • Decreased appetite, sometimes leading to weight loss

What is the definition of binge drinking? 

Four or more drinks for women, or five or more drinks for men during an occasion in approximately two hours.

Problem?  Me? 

  • Loss of control: Using more or for longer than intended.

  • Inability to quit: Wanting to stop but not being able to.

  • Time spent using: Spending a lot of time getting, using, or recovering from THC.

  • Cravings: Strong urges to use, even when not using.

  • Neglecting responsibilities: Missing work, school, or family obligations.

  • Ignoring risks: Using despite dangers (e.g., driving under the influence).

  • Worsening problems: Continuing use even if it’s making your health, relationships, or job worse.

  • Tolerance: Needing more THC to feel the same effect.

  • Withdrawal symptoms: Irritability, sleep issues, or cravings when not using.

  • Disproportionate focus: Prioritizing THC use over other activities.
